Tipri - Bunjwah, Kishtwar

Tipri is a village situated in the Bunjwah tehsil of Kishtwar district, Jammu And Kashmir. It is located approximately 40 km from Kishtwar and around 40 km from Kishtwar. Tipri village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Tipri is 004724. The village covers a total geographical area of 528.5 hectares and falls under the 182203 pincode. Kishtwar is the nearest town, located about 42 km away.

Tipri village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Inderwal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Udhampur  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Tipri

As per Census 2011, Tipri village has a total population of 1,924 people, consisting of 1,014 males and 910 females. The village has 366 households and a sex ratio of 897 females per 1,000 males. There are 418 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 659 literate and 1,265 illiterate residents. Additionally, 365 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1,257 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
